Dipole Perturbations of the Reissner-Nordstrom Solution: The Polar Case

Abstract

The formalism developed by Chandrasekhar for the linear polar perturbations of the Reissner-Nordstrom solution is generalized to include the case of dipole (l=1) perturbations. Then, the perturbed metric coefficients and components of the Maxwell tensor are computed.
